Argus Labs is building the next generation of massively multiplayer online (MMO) games by empowering players with the extensive freedom to build, extend, and influence the game worlds they inhabit. Our approach is centered around World Engine, our state-of-the-art onchain game server framework.
World Engine leverages a novel sharded rollup blockchain architecture, which allows games to use smart contracts for user-generated content (UGC) while scaling to tens of thousands of concurrent users without compromising performance. To date, World Engine is the most performant blockchain designed from the ground up for games and has been used in production for games like Dark Frontier, processing 700K+ player transactions within a week.

Is Kubernetes high demand?
Yes, Kubernetes is currently in high demand in the technology industry
Kubernetes is an open-source container orchestration platform that is widely used for deploying, scaling, and managing containerized applications
It provides a standardized way to manage and automate the deployment of containerized applications across multiple hosts and provides benefits such as reliability, scalability, and flexibility
As more and more organizations move towards containerized architectures, Kubernetes has become a critical component of their infrastructure
Kubernetes is used by companies of all sizes, from startups to large enterprises, and across various industries, including finance, healthcare, and e-commerce
According to various job market and salary surveys, Kubernetes-related skills are in high demand, and job positions related to Kubernetes are growing at a rapid pace
In fact, Kubernetes is often listed as one of the top skills that are in high demand by technology companies
Overall, Kubernetes is a highly sought-after skill in the technology industry, and it's likely to remain in high demand in the foreseeable future as more and more organizations adopt containerization and cloud-native architectures.
